Yoruba Nollywood actress, Deborah Shokoya otherwise known as Debbie is reflecting on her painful pregnancy loss.

The movie star made it clear that she wasn’t making a pity video, rather she was sharing her testimony as she noted how many pregnant women died with their child in their womb, and some died after giving birth.

Debbie stated that though it didn’t go as she planned, it went as God planned and she is super grateful. She added that she knows pains and bruises but she is stronger than them all.

Debbie used the opportunity to announce the coming of her new movie, which celebrates her strength as a woman and an actress.

 She revealed that she shot the movie with her baby bump because she has always looked forward to shooting a movie while pregnant and she did, even though she lost the baby.

The newly married expressed gratitude to her husband, whom she called her better half

 “A Big Thank You To My Darling, Amazing, Supportive Better Half My Husband Adetola
God Is Working And My Testimony Is Beautiful”.

In August, Debbie Shokoya in an emotional video on her Instagram page, tearfully recounted how she lost her pregnancy at 8 months.

According to her, everyone knew she was pregnant and she had even traveled out expecting to return with her child, but unfortunately, things happened and she had a miscarriage.

Begging for people to not bash her, she noted how she sacrificed and went through a lot for her unborn child, only for her to lose the pregnancy.

In tears, she stated that it hadn’t been easy for her as she bonded with her child so well before the loss.
